What Fish Can You Catch While Charter Fishing in Montego Bay?

Alright, let's talk about what you can actually catch when you go charter fishing in Montego Bay. The waters here are known for their rich diversity of marine life. This means that you've got a fantastic chance of hooking a variety of impressive species. One of the most sought-after catches is the marlin, known for its impressive size and the thrilling fight it puts up when hooked. Imagine battling a marlin – a true test of skill and endurance! Other popular targets include tuna, known for their delicious taste and energetic fight. Then there's the mahi-mahi, also known as dorado or dolphin fish, a beautiful and vibrant fish that puts on an incredible aerial display when hooked. These fish are not only beautiful but are also excellent eating, providing a tasty reward for your efforts. You can also expect to encounter species like wahoo, known for their speed and sharp teeth, and snapper, a tasty bottom-dwelling fish. And let's not forget the various types of sharks, which can add a thrilling element to your fishing adventure. The specific species you'll encounter will depend on the time of year, with different fish migrating through the area at different times. Your charter operator will have the most up-to-date information on the best times to fish for specific species. They'll also provide guidance on the techniques and tackle needed to target these fish. Keep in mind that some species may be subject to catch-and-release regulations to help maintain the health of the local fish population. You can check with your charter operator for the latest rules. Choosing the Right Charter for Your Montego Bay Fishing Trip

Choosing the right charter is a super important step when planning your Montego Bay fishing trip. With so many options available, it's essential to find a charter that aligns with your needs and preferences. So, how do you go about it, you ask? Well, here are some tips to get you started! First off, start by doing your homework. Research the different charter companies operating in Montego Bay. Check out their websites, read online reviews, and see what other anglers have to say about their experiences. This can give you valuable insights into the quality of service, the professionalism of the crew, and the overall experience offered by each charter. Look for charters with a good reputation, experienced captains, and well-maintained boats. Secondly, consider your fishing goals and experience level. Are you a seasoned angler looking for a challenging deep-sea fishing experience, or are you a beginner who wants a more relaxed and family-friendly trip? Some charters specialize in specific types of fishing, such as marlin fishing or reef fishing. Others offer a more general experience suitable for all skill levels. Make sure the charter you choose caters to your preferences. Thirdly, ask about the boats and equipment. A well-equipped boat is essential for a safe and successful fishing trip. Ensure the charter operates modern, well-maintained boats equipped with the necessary safety gear, such as life jackets, first-aid kits, and communication equipment. The quality of the fishing equipment, including rods, reels, and tackle, is also important. Some charters provide high-end gear, while others offer more basic equipment. Choose a charter that provides gear that matches your level of experience and the type of fishing you plan to do. Fourthly, check the crew's experience and expertise. The captain and crew can make or break your fishing trip. Look for charters with experienced and knowledgeable captains who know the local waters and have a proven track record of catching fish. The crew should be friendly, professional, and able to provide guidance and assistance throughout the trip. They should be willing to share their expertise, teach you fishing techniques, and answer any questions you may have. Finally, consider the price and what's included. Charter prices can vary depending on the length of the trip, the type of fishing, the boat, and the amenities offered. Make sure you understand what's included in the price, such as fishing equipment, bait, tackle, drinks, and snacks. Some charters may also offer add-ons, such as lunch, transportation, or even onboard cooking of your catch. Compare prices from different charters and make sure you're getting a good value for your money. Remember, choosing the right charter is about finding a company that provides a safe, enjoyable, and successful fishing experience tailored to your needs. Planning Your Charter Fishing Trip: Tips and Tricks

Alright, you've chosen your charter. Now let's talk about planning the rest of your charter fishing trip to make sure it goes as smoothly as possible. Preparation is key, guys!

First and foremost, book your charter in advance. Especially if you're traveling during peak season, booking early ensures you get your preferred dates and time slots. Popular charters often fill up quickly, so don't wait until the last minute. Second, pack the right gear and essentials. While most charters provide fishing equipment, you'll still want to bring some personal items. This includes sunscreen, a hat, sunglasses, and appropriate clothing. The sun can be intense on the open water, so protecting your skin is crucial. Also, bring seasickness medication if you're prone to it. A camera is a must for capturing your amazing catches and the beautiful scenery. Lastly, don’t forget to pack any snacks or drinks that you might want. Third, know the local regulations. Familiarize yourself with Jamaica's fishing regulations, including catch limits, size restrictions, and any seasonal closures. Your charter operator will provide guidance, but it's always good to be informed. Understanding the rules helps ensure responsible and sustainable fishing practices. Fourth, listen to your captain and crew. They are the experts, and they know the best fishing spots and techniques. Pay attention to their instructions, ask questions, and follow their guidance. They'll also provide you with valuable insights into local marine life and the environment. Fifth, be prepared for the weather. Check the weather forecast before your trip and dress accordingly. The weather in Jamaica can change quickly, so be prepared for both sun and rain. Waterproof gear can be a lifesaver. Finally, consider tipping your crew. Tipping is customary in the charter fishing industry. A standard tip is typically 15-20% of the charter fee, depending on the quality of service. Show your appreciation for their hard work and expertise. By following these tips, you'll be well-prepared for your charter fishing adventure in Montego Bay. Frequently Asked Questions About Montego Bay Charter Fishing

Here are some of the most common questions people have when planning their Montego Bay charter fishing adventure:

  • What's the best time of year for fishing in Montego Bay? The peak season for fishing is generally from November to May when the weather is at its finest, and various species, such as marlin, tuna, and mahi-mahi are most active. However, good fishing can be found year-round. It depends on what you're hoping to catch. Different fish have different seasons.
  • How long are fishing charters in Montego Bay? Charter durations can vary from a half-day (4 hours) to a full-day (8 hours) or even longer. Consider your budget, time constraints, and the type of fishing you want to do when deciding on the length of your trip.
  • What should I bring on a fishing charter? Essentials include sunscreen, a hat, sunglasses, appropriate clothing, and seasickness medication if needed. Most charters provide fishing equipment, but you might want to bring your own if you have a preference. Don't forget a camera to capture the memories.
  • Do I need a fishing license? No, you typically do not need a fishing license for charter fishing in Jamaica. The charter operator is usually responsible for any required permits. Check with your chosen charter operator to confirm.
  • What's the cost of a fishing charter in Montego Bay? The cost varies depending on the length of the trip, the size of the boat, and the amenities offered. Expect to pay anywhere from a few hundred to over a thousand dollars for a charter. Prices are also affected by the type of fish you are going for, the gear required, and how many people are in your party. Be sure to shop around and compare rates from different charters.
  • Are fishing charters suitable for families with children? Yes, absolutely! Many charters cater to families with children and provide a safe and enjoyable experience. Look for charters that offer family-friendly options and have experienced crew members who are good with kids.
  • What happens if we catch a fish? If you catch a fish, you have several options. You can choose to release it (catch and release), keep it (if it meets size and species regulations), or have the crew clean it for you to take back to your accommodation to cook. Confirm the regulations with your charter operator.
  • What if I get seasick? If you're prone to seasickness, take medication before the trip. It's also wise to stay hydrated, eat light snacks, and stay in the fresh air. Your charter operator can provide advice to minimize seasickness. Most boats also have enclosed areas where you can rest if you feel unwell.
